What HUD's PIH Record for Housing Authority of the City of Redondo Beach Tells You

Housing Authority of the City of Redondo Beach is one of 3,780 agencies HUD tracks in its PIH Open Data directory for the Section 8 / Housing Choice Voucher program operating in CA. HUD authorizes 653 Section 8 / HCV units for this agency.

Ranked by Section 8 unit count within CA, it sits at the 25th percentile there, ahead of 25% of CA PHAs by that measure. HUD's directory categorizes it under the "Section 8" program type, the classification that governs which voucher streams -- regular HCV, VASH, Family Unification, Mainstream, or project-based conversions -- it is eligible to run. HUD sets the ceiling; each PHA still runs its own waitlist, admissions plan, and local preferences under the federal Section 8 rulebook, so the number above caps capacity without guaranteeing an open list today.

What to expect, typical waitlist

HUD does not publish current waitlist open/closed status centrally, and waitlist lengths vary sharply by local demand. In high-cost metros, waits can exceed 5–10 years and many waitlists are closed. In smaller cities and rural counties, waits of 6 months to 3 years are more typical. Some PHAs use a lottery rather than first-come-first-served. This site does not predict your individual wait time. Contact the PHA directly to confirm the current list status and whether local preferences apply to your household. Payment standard reference

Payment standards are set per HUD FMR area, not per agency. Across CA's 51 HUD FMR areas, the FY2025 2-bedroom payment standard ranges $1,054–$4,223/month (median $1,505). Housing Authority of the City of Redondo Beach sets its own figure within 90–110% of HUD's Fair Market Rent for the specific area it serves.
